Starkey Edge AI RIC

The Starkey Edge AI RIC is a premium prescription hearing aid released in 2024, priced at $5,000. In our lab testing, it earned a SoundScore of 4.0/5 (A grade), ranking #18 of 36 prescription hearing aids tested—placing it in the top 47% of its category. This behind-the-ear device demonstrates notable strengths in music streaming, scoring 3.8/5—a solid result that's 1.16 points above the category average of 2.64. Speech-in-noise performance also stands out at 1.05 points above average, though the absolute score of 2.6/5 reflects the inherent difficulty of this listening scenario across all devices. Speech in quiet measures 3.8/5, a solid score that's 0.37 points above the prescription category average. The Edge AI shows meaningful improvement with professional fitting. The normalized Initial Score of 3.8/5 climbs to 4.5/5 when tuned—a 0.7-point gain that underscores the value of working with a hearing care professional. Feedback handling remains excellent at 4.7/5 in absolute terms, though this falls just below the category average. Own-voice comfort scores 2.8/5, slightly above average but reflecting mixed absolute performance typical of this challenging metric. The Edge AI RIC is best suited for users who prioritize streaming quality and are committed to professional fitting optimization. It competes in a price tier with strong alternatives like the Oticon Intent (4.75/5) and Phonak Sphere Infinio (4.65/5), which outperform it on overall sound scores. This 2024 Expert's Choice Award recipient offers reliable performance with rechargeable batteries and hands-free streaming to both iPhone and Android devices.

Starkey Omega AI

The Starkey Omega AI is a premium behind-the-ear prescription hearing aid released in 2025, currently available at $3,998. In our lab testing, it earned an A grade with a SoundScore of 4.3/5, placing it at #2 among 36 prescription hearing aids tested—in the top 3% of its category. Speech performance is a clear strength. Speech in quiet scores a strong 4.0/5, sitting 0.57 points above the category average. Speech in noise performs 1.35 points above category average, though at 2.9/5 it remains mixed in absolute terms—better than most competitors but still challenging in demanding listening environments. Music streaming earns a solid 3.2/5, outpacing the category average by 0.56 points. Own-voice comfort scores 2.7/5, essentially matching the category average with a negligible 0.05-point difference below. Feedback handling is excellent at 4.6/5 in absolute terms, though this sits 0.11 points below the category average—reflecting how well prescription aids generally manage feedback rather than any significant weakness. The Omega AI competes in a crowded premium tier alongside devices like the Oticon Intent and Phonak Sphere Infinio, which score higher overall. However, Starkey's latest offering delivers strong speech clarity and above-average streaming quality. It's well-suited for users who prioritize speech understanding and want reliable Bluetooth connectivity with both iPhone and Android devices, along with hands-free calling capability.
